使用命令行提升效率哪些Linux命令是必备的

时间:2025-10-27 分类:操作系统

在现代社会,命令行作为一种强大的工具,为程序员和系统管理员提供了高效、灵活的操作方式。掌握Linux命令行的基本指令,不仅能够提高日常工作的效率,还能帮助用户更深入地理解操作系统的运行机制。在Linux环境中,有若干命令是必不可少的,它们涵盖了文件管理、系统监控、网络配置等多个方面。无论是在进行软件开发,还是在进行服务器管理,这些命令都能带来显著的便利。如何利用这些命令实现工作流程的优化,将是本篇文章的核心内容。

使用命令行提升效率哪些Linux命令是必备的

`ls`命令是查看目录内容的基础指令。通过它,用户可以迅速获取文件和文件夹的列表,并结合不同参数获取详细信息,如大小、权限和最后修改时间。这能够帮助用户快速判断目录结构以及文件管理状态。

紧接着,文件操作命令如`cp`(复制)、`mv`(移动)和`rm`(删除)是日常使用中必不可少的工具。`cp`允许用户轻松创建文件的副本,而`mv`则多用于组织文件夹中的内容,帮助用户保持文件结构的整洁。`rm`命令具有强大的删除功能,但因其不可恢复的特性,使用时需格外小心。

`grep`命令可以有效地从文件中查找特定的文本,这在处理日志文件或大量数据时尤为重要。借助于此命令,用户可以迅速定位问题,节省大量时间。搭配管道符`|`,用户可以将多个命令组合起来,形成复杂的数据处理流程。

对于系统监控,`top`和`htop`命令是非常实用的工具。`top`展示了系统当前的进程运行情况,包括CPU和内存的使用情况,便于用户实时监控系统性能。而`htop`是`top`的增强版,提供了更友好的界面和更多的功能选项,方便用户进行资源管理。

网络相关的命令如`ping`和`netstat`同样不可忽视。`ping`能够检测网络连接的状态,帮助用户判断网络是否正常;而`netstat`则能列出系统的网络连接状态,详细展示各个端口的使用情况。这些命令使得网络故障排查变得更加高效。

掌握这些Linux命令,不仅能提升工作效率,还能帮助用户更好地适应快速变化的技术环境。通过不断学习和实践,用户能够在命令行中游刃有余,开启更高效的工作方式。